What are the risks of buying land?

Environmental Issues You could encounter high levels of radon or asbestos. The soil could be unstable and unfit to build on. If you build on soil that is not stable, it could cause the foundation of your property to crack. The land could be located in a flood zone.

Do banks finance vacant land?

Banks are reluctant to finance vacant land, as they consider it a riskier asset. Banks are also reluctant to finance loans for vacant property, and will finance a 60% bond at best. This means that you’ll need a 40% cash deposit at hand to secure a loan.

Does land ever lose value?

Land, like any asset, can go down in value, but it doesn’t depreciate in the accounting sense. This is important to businesses, because the depreciation of assets is tax-deductible as a business expense.

Can you buy and hold land?

Buy and hold Some land investors will buy raw land with the intent to hold the land long term. They may want to develop the land in the future, want to wait for the demand to increase (thus increasing the value of the land), or want to hold their land rights, which could include water, air, or mineral rights.
